It's funny - I've had a range of new experiences over the past month or so which is odd because we are so close to the end of an expansion.
Firstly I finally got a level 80 melee class (Cynicism the Rogue), who I am quite fond of but find extremely frustrating to play. Last night I finally got her fourth piece for T9 gear,which puts her at the dizzy heights of a GS of 4460.
Trying to remain modest, I am doing quite well, in part. She seems to be able to hold her own for her GS (I, for one, and appreciative of the DPS/GS panel in recount), and in a simple tank and spank fight I have a solid enough spec and rotation that I can pull 4-5k.
Where I struggle is the not so simple fights.
- As a hunter/priest I rarely consider the green/red/purple/blue crap at the bosses feet. As a rogue is kind of important!
- As a hunter/priest I don't really care if the tank decides to move the boss 10 yards to the left. As a rogue you suddenly find yourself stabbing thin air
For Cynicism ToC went like this:
- Gormak - stealthed, I received a whisper telling me that Gormak can see stealth rogues and to move back. Good advice!
- Acidmaw and Dreadscale One - At the worms thought I did ok until I died to green slime pool/poison cloud that Acidmaw produces. We wiped at this attempt but was quite pleased I'd run to the burning bile when I had the paralytic toxin on me.
- Acidmaw and Dreadscale Two - received a whisper telling me I could use Cloak of Shadows to get out of the toxin and burning. Made use of this new piece of information when I got burning bile next. Unfortunately the tank had the paralytic toxin at the time - silly rogue! Alas I once again died in the poison cloud but the beasts were dropped
I can only blame myself, its just another thing you have to consider which I never had to think about before. I am guessing it comes with experience, but how frustrating it is dying to dumb stuff?
- Jaraxxus - dont ask. For some reason I stood in front of the boss as the tank was standing behind and would have turned him. I was therefore preparing for being behind him to do my interupts. I died. At the pull. Cant say I blame him.
- Faction Champs - sapped the paladin healer. He broke it and one shot me before I could get get another stun on him. Watched as the rest of the group cleared them.
- Twins - managed to interrupt the heal after the shield came down. I spammed kick with all three shields. Recount showed I was successful with 1, the other two covered by other players.
- Anub'arak - probably my best performance of the night. I stabbed and swang and the boss died. I won an axe. I was happy.
There have been other incidents - for example, the Maiden of Grief in HoS. She does the large black voids, and I knew about these and I got out of them. Good rogue! The trouble is this:
Here I am stabbing away at the big bad boss lady.
She drops the void.
The tanks moves out and I move out, but in the opposite direction because that's the nearest edge.
The result? I have to run all the way around before being able to carry on attacking! Its so damn frustrating!!!
But still - it wouldnt be a challenge if it was easy would it. I just have to break a few of the ingrained habits I have learnt over the years and form some new ones. I honestly think that knowing a melee class will allow me to improve all my toons, its going to speed up my reactions a lot at least.
